Why Fees Matter
Trading fees can take various forms, consisting of:
Trading Fees: Charged per trade carried out on the exchange.Withdrawal Fees: Imposed when withdrawing funds from an exchange.Deposit Fees: Charged for transferring funds into an account.Lack of exercise Fees: Applicable if an account stays dormant for a particular duration.
Lower fees imply more money in your pocket, which can be crucial for frequent traders or those handling lower volumes.

Binance
Binance is among the largest cryptocurrency exchanges globally by trading volume. It charges a flat trading fee of 0.1%, which can be further minimized to 0.075% by opting to pay fees in BNB (Binance Coin). The platform likewise uses a range of services, consisting of futures trading, staking, and savings products.
2. Coinbase Pro
Coinbase Pro is a professional trading platform offered by Coinbase, which enables lower fees compared to the basic Coinbase platform. Fees range from 0% to 0.5%, depending on the trading volume. The user interface is beginner-friendly, with a strong technical analysis toolkit.
3. Kraken
Kraken stands apart for its innovative security features and broad selection of cryptocurrencies. With trading fees varying from 0.16% to 0.26% based upon the user's 30-day trading volume, it supplies competitive rates, especially for traders with considerable volume.
4. KuCoin
Known for its substantial altcoin offerings, KuCoin charges a flat trading fee of 0.1%. The platform encourages trading through numerous incentives, including KuCoin shares which provide discounts on trading fees.
5. Bitstamp
Bitstamp is one of the most dependable names in the crypto space. It uses a trading fee structure based on volume, starting at 0.5% for lower trading volumes and dropping to 0.0% as trading volume boosts. Users value the exchange for its regulatory compliance and straightforward interface.
